What is the FOIA Request Form?
The FOIA Request Form serves as a crucial tool under the Freedom of Information Act to facilitate public access to government records. It specifically pertains to the U.S. Nuclear Regulatory Commission (NRC), which processes these requests for records.
This form is primarily used for asking for information related to training materials concerning the Combined License (COL) process, allowing users to seek essential documentation efficiently.

Submission Methods and Delivery of the FOIA Request Form
Users can submit their completed FOIA Request Form through several methods, including:
-
Online submission via the NRC's designated portal
-
Mailing a hard copy to the appropriate NRC office
-
In-person submission at the NRC headquarters
It's essential to consider any applicable fees or supporting documents required to process the request. Furthermore, tracking submissions can offer users confirmation of delivery and progress updates.

What are the eligibility requirements to submit a FOIA Request Form?
Anyone, including individuals, organizations, and businesses, may submit a FOIA Request Form. There are no eligibility restrictions based on citizenship or residency.
Is there a deadline for submitting FOIA requests?
FOIA requests can be submitted at any time. However, consider the processing times of the agency you are requesting information from; they may vary depending on the complexity of the request.
How do I submit the completed FOIA Request Form?
You can either download the completed FOIA Request Form and submit it via mail or submit it electronically through pdfFiller, depending on the instructions provided by the specific agency you are contacting.
What supporting documents do I need to include with my FOIA request?
Typically, you do not need to submit supporting documents with the FOIA Request Form itself, but you should provide a clear description of the documents you are requesting to facilitate the search process.
What are common mistakes to avoid when filling out the FOIA Request Form?
Common mistakes include incomplete information, vague descriptions of the requested documents, and failing to provide accurate contact details. Always double-check these before submission.
How long does it typically take to process a FOIA request?
Processing times can vary widely, from a few days to several weeks or months, depending on the complexity of the request and the agency’s workload. It's advisable to check with the specific agency for their expected timelines.
What if my FOIA request is denied?
If your FOIA request is denied, you will receive a written explanation. You have the right to appeal the decision, which you can typically do by following the instructions given in the denial notice.
